Top Guidelines Of iOS freelancer
Get the job done with the new iOS app advancement specialist to get a demo period (pay back only if contented), ensuring they're the appropriate match before beginning the engagement.
Robert is an iOS developer using a prosperous practical experience of perfectly more than a decade underneath his belt. He has labored on acquiring several different applications across domains. Many of his work features assignments in social media, leisure, chat dependent apps.
With above ten years of programming encounter and more than eight a long time as a business operator, Lorand appreciates the significance of excellent conversation and comprehending using a client.
Synchronously loading Website. If loading is completed synchronously, it can stall out the key thread when the data hundreds, which could bring about a perceptible lag when scrolling. This is a particularly widespread difficulty when visuals are being downloaded for displaying in table cells.
In addition to a cellular application can Acquire insightful user information and responses to improve your merchandise offerings. All round, utilizing mobile app developers might help extend your company and greatly enhance shopper pleasure, inevitably resulting in far more profits and profitability.
But with no being familiar with multithreading, a developer can't correctly utilize Main Facts or Realm considering the fact that information persisting and consuming operations will need watchful management when getting used in multiple threads concurrently.
As well as NSError, iOS improvement also has NSException. Contrary to exceptions in other languages, NSException is meant for use for programming mistakes only. Cocoa frameworks in general usually are not exception-Secure, so in case you make (or invoke code that generates) exceptions, treatment needs to be taken to employ test/catch as shut as possible into the location where the exception is happening. In practice, NSException is never used in iOS check here codebases.
Tripcents would not exist devoid of Toptal. Toptal Jobs enabled us to quickly establish our foundation with an item supervisor, lead developer, and senior designer. In just more than 60 times we went from principle to Alpha.
A common sample is to use respondsToSelector: to check out if a delegate object implements an optional process prior to sending it that concept. By way of example:
Very affordable answers for your creativeness needs! I am a Resourceful designer and developer on a route to develop revolutionary condition-of-the-art products and services. Over the years, I've obtained mastery in Net/App Progress in addition to Graphic Planning. MASTERED Products and services:
Developers generally comply with coding model guides from nicely-known builders and companies. Apple’s coding design and style alterations normally and is difficult to stay caught up with, but Below are a few other superior requirements:
RayGun is usually a typically employed debugging Instrument in iOS enhancement. It's a top quality Resource that demonstrates consumers how folks interact with the iOS application created.
NSZombies in advance of publishing the app towards the Application Retail store. When NSZombies is enabled, no objects are launched and you may be leaking memory consistently right up until your app ultimately is killed click here on account of memory warnings.
“The cooperation with Christos was superb. I am website able to only give favourable responses about him. Moreover his general coding, just how of composing exams and making ready documentation has enriched our crew a great deal. It is a superb included price in each individual staff.â€